Wie erstellt man ein Excel-Makro, das beim Klick auf Button 4 die Zeilen 28 bis 30 ein- und ausblendet?

Antwort

Hier ist ein Beispiel für ein Excel-Makro, das beim Klick auf einen Button (z.B. „Button 4“) die Zeilen 28 bis 30 ein- oder ausblendet – je nachdem, ob sie aktuell ausgeblendet sind oder nicht: ```vba Sub ToggleRows28to30() With Rows("28:30") .Hidden = Not .Hidden End With End Sub ``` **So funktioniert es:** - Das Makro prüft, ob die Zeilen 28 bis 30 aktuell ausgeblendet sind (`.Hidden = True`). - Sind sie ausgeblendet, werden sie eingeblendet. - Sind sie eingeblendet, werden sie ausgeblendet. **Anleitung zur Zuweisung:** 1. Öffne den VBA-Editor mit `ALT + F11`. 2. Füge das Makro in ein Modul ein. 3. Wechsle zurück zu Excel. 4. Füge einen Button (z.B. über „Entwicklertools > Einfügen > Formularsteuerelemente > Button“) ein. 5. Weise dem Button das Makro `ToggleRows28to30` zu. Weitere Infos zu Makros findest du z.B. bei [Microsoft](https://support.microsoft.com/de-de/office/erstellen-oder-l%C3%B6schen-eines-makros-5e855fd2-02d1-45f5-90a3-50e645fe3155).

Kategorie: Office Tags: Excel Makro Zeilen
Neue Frage stellen

Verwandte Fragen

Wie kann man mit einem Excel-Makro den Bereich Range(Cells(i, 3), Cells(i, 8)) schützen?

Um in Excel mit einem Makro (VBA) einen bestimmten Zellbereich – zum Beispiel von Spalte 3 (C) bis Spalte 8 (H) in Zeile i – zu schützen, gehst du wie folgt vor: 1. **Zellen entsperr... [mehr]

Wie lässt sich in einer Excel-Datei per Makro der Blattschutz des aktuellen Blattes entfernen?

Um in einer Excel-Datei per Makro (VBA) den Blattschutz des aktuellen Blattes zu entfernen, kannst du folgenden VBA-Code verwenden: ```vba Sub BlattschutzEntfernen() ActiveSheet.Unprotect End Sub... [mehr]

Wie kann ich per Makro im Blatt Ziel den Bereich von D5 bis INDIREKT(G8) aus dem Blatt Team ab Zelle L12 einfügen?

Um den Bereich von `D5` bis zu der Zelle, die durch `INDIREKT(G8)` im Blatt „Team“ definiert ist, per Makro auszuwählen und ins Blatt „Ziel“ ab Zelle `L12` zu kopieren, ka... [mehr]

Wie schreibe ich ein Makro, das Zeilen aus verschiedenen Excel-Arbeitsblättern kopiert und in ein anderes Blatt einfügt?

Um ein Makro in Excel zu schreiben, das Zeilen aus unterschiedlichen Arbeitsblättern kopiert und in ein anderes Arbeitsblatt einfügt, kannst du den VBA-Editor verwenden. Hier ist ein einfach... [mehr]

Wie kopiere ich per Makro ein einzelnes Arbeitsblatt in Excel?

Um in Excel per Makro (VBA) eine Kopie eines einzelnen Arbeitsblatts zu erstellen, kannst du folgenden VBA-Code verwenden: ```vba Sub BlattKopieren() ' Name des zu kopierenden Blatts Dim... [mehr]

Wie kann ich in Excel Zellen so formatieren, dass automatisch in jedem Feld ein fester Wert abgezogen wird?

Um in Excel automatisch in einer Zelle einen festen Wert von einem anderen Wert abzuziehen, kannst du eine Formel verwenden. Eine direkte Zellformatierung, die Werte verändert (wie z.B. „im... [mehr]

Wie kann ich in Excel die erste Spalte und die Überschriften gleichzeitig fixieren?

Um in Excel sowohl die erste Spalte als auch die Überschriften (also die oberste Zeile) gleichzeitig zu fixieren, gehe wie folgt vor: 1. **Markiere die Zelle B2** (also die Zelle direkt unter de... [mehr]

Wie verwende ich die ROUND-Funktion bei einer Verknüpfung in Excel?

Um die **ROUND**-Funktion (auf Deutsch: **RUNDEN**) in einer Verknüpfung in Excel zu verwenden, kannst du sie direkt in deine Formel einbauen. Die Funktion rundet eine Zahl auf eine bestimmte Anz... [mehr]

Wie entferne ich in Excel versehentlich eingefügte, unendlich breite Zellen?

Wenn deine Excel-Tabelle unendlich breit erscheint, hast du vermutlich versehentlich Daten oder Formatierungen in sehr viele Spalten eingefügt. So kannst du die überflüssigen Zellen/Spa... [mehr]

Wie füge ich eine Filterfunktion in ein Excel-Diagramm ein?

Um eine Filterfunktion in ein Excel-Diagramm einzubauen, gibt es verschiedene Möglichkeiten. Die gängigsten Methoden sind: **1. Diagramm mit einer Tabelle verknüpfen:** - Erstelle dein... [mehr]